WebA thermometer is calibrated by using two objects of known temperatures. The typical process involves using the freezing point and the boiling point of pure water. Water is known to freeze at 0°C and to boil at 100°C at an atmospheric pressure of 1 atm. WebYummly Smart Thermometer. how many mph is 220 kphWebWorking of Infrared Thermometers. Similar to visible light, it is also possible to focus, reflect, or absorb infrared light. Infrared thermometers employ a lens to focus the infrared light emitting from the object onto a detector known as a thermopile.
